Funimation made one of their big licensing announcements yesterday, and among the myriad of series with formerly Bandai Entertainment held licenses they have picked up were these.:

Crest of the Stars
Banner of the Stars
Banner of the Stars II
Passage of the Stars "Birth"


Already own Crest and both Banners, but looking forward to the prospect of an official DVD release for Passage. Who knows, maybe this could even lead to Banner III's license being picked up in the near future.
